Transaction 61d4877db7b5647de8f324382c25a1208716b6cd1f7c2c042b4bd36be8bfcdae
1 Input
1 Output
-
61d4877db7b5647de8f324382c25a1208716b6cd1f7c2c042b4bd36be8bfcdae:0
- value
- 375069
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 42d331ec4d6135c0f84ae4ad922fdfda6dd13bf9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 176LbkMZUZwzPZVrC7epWNjjrP8Dcya9A1